Win7虚拟机XP密码遗忘解决指南

win7下虚拟机xp 密码忘记

时间:2025-01-26 10:39


解决Win7下虚拟机XP密码忘记的终极指南 在使用Windows 7操作系统的计算机上,通过虚拟机软件(如VMware、VirtualBox等)运行Windows XP系统,已成为许多用户进行兼容性测试、旧软件运行或学习目的的重要手段

    然而,有时候我们可能会遇到一种尴尬的情况:虚拟机中的Windows XP系统密码忘记了

    这不仅会阻碍我们的工作进度,还可能带来一些不必要的麻烦

    幸运的是,通过一些技巧和工具,我们可以有效解决这一问题

    本文将详细介绍在Windows 7下虚拟机Windows XP密码忘记后的几种可靠解决方案,帮助您迅速恢复对虚拟机系统的访问权限

     一、理解问题的本质 首先,我们需要明确问题的本质:虚拟机中的Windows XP系统密码遗忘,意味着我们无法通过正常的登录流程进入系统

    这里的关键在于绕过或重置系统密码,而非破解或暴力破解(这些方法不仅耗时且可能违法)

     二、准备工具与环境 在开始解决问题之前,确保您已准备好以下工具和环境: 1.Windows 7宿主机:这是运行虚拟机软件的物理计算机

     2.虚拟机软件:如VMware Workstation、VMware Player、VirtualBox等

     3.Windows XP虚拟机镜像:已安装并配置好的Windows XP系统虚拟机

     4.Windows PE启动盘/USB:用于启动虚拟机至Windows PE环境,方便进行密码重置操作

     5.密码重置工具:如Ophcrack、Offline NT Password & Registry Editor(Offline NT Password Editor, 简称NTPasswd)等

     6.ISO镜像文件:如Hirens BootCD,集成了多种系统维护工具,包括密码重置工具

     三、方案一:使用Windows PE启动虚拟机 1.制作Windows PE启动盘: - 下载并安装Windows AIK(Windows Automated Installation Kit)

     - 使用AIK中的工具创建自定义的Windows PE启动盘或USB驱动器

     2.配置虚拟机从Windows PE启动: - 在虚拟机设置中,将虚拟机的光驱或USB控制器配置为使用您刚创建的Windows PE启动盘/USB

     - 启动虚拟机,选择从光驱或USB启动

     3.在Windows PE环境中重置密码: - 进入Windows PE后,使用内置的命令行工具(如`cmd`)或第三方密码重置工具(如NTPasswd)

     - 查找Windows XP系统的SAM(Security Accounts Manager)文件,通常位于`C:WindowsSystem32config`目录下

     - 使用NTPasswd等工具清除或重置目标用户账户的密码

     4.重启虚拟机并登录: - 完成密码重置后,重启虚拟机,此时应能使用新设置的密码或无密码登录Windows XP系统

     四、方案二:使用Hirens BootCD Hirens BootCD是一个集成了多种系统维护工具和实用程序的启动光盘,非常适合处理密码遗忘等问题

     1.下载并刻录Hirens BootCD: - 从官方网站下载最新版本的Hirens BootCD ISO镜像文件

     - 使用光盘刻录软件将ISO文件刻录到空白光盘上,或使用工具将ISO文件加载到USB驱动器中

     2.配置虚拟机从Hirens BootCD启动: - 在虚拟机设置中,将虚拟机的光驱配置为使用Hirens BootCD

     - 启动虚拟机,选择从光驱启动

     3.在Hirens BootCD环境中重置密码: - 进入Hirens BootCD菜单后,选择“Mini XP”或“Windows PE”等选项进入图形界面

     - 使用内置的密码重置工具(如NTPasswd或Chntpw)找到并重置Windows XP系统的用户密码

     4.重启虚拟机并登录: - 完成密码重置后,重启虚拟机,使用新密码登录系统

     五、方案三:利用虚拟机快照功能 如果您在使用虚拟机时定期创建快照,那么利用快照功能恢复到一个密码已知的状态也是一个快速且有效的解决方案

     1.查找并恢复快照: - 打开虚拟机软件,找到虚拟机配置文件中的快照管理功能

     - 在快照列表中,选择一个在您记得密码时创建的快照

     - 选择“恢复到快照”选项

     2.验证恢复结果: - 虚拟机将重启并恢复到快照创建时的状态,包括系统配置和用户数据

     - 使用之前已知的密码登录系统,验证恢复是否成功

     六、预防措施与最佳实践 尽管有上述解决方案,但最好的办法是避免密码遗忘的发生

    以下是一些预防措施和最佳实践: 1.使用密码管理工具:采用密码管理器来记录和存储重要账户的密码,确保密码的安全性和可访问性

     2.定期备份虚拟机:除了快照功能外,还应定期对整个虚拟机进行完整备份,以便在出现问题时快速恢复

     3.设置密码提示:在Windows XP系统中设置密码提示(尽管这可能会降低安全性),帮助您回忆起密码

     4.启用自动登录:对于非生产环境,可以考虑配置Windows XP自动登录功能,但注意这会增加安全风险

     5.加强安全意识培训:定期提醒和教育用户关于密码安全的重要性,避免使用简单密码或重复使用密码

     七、结语 忘记虚拟机中Windows XP系统的密码确实是一个令人头疼的问题,但通过正确的工具和步骤,我们可以有效地解决这一难题

    无论是使用Windows PE启动盘、Hirens BootCD还是利用虚拟机快照功能,每种方法都有其独特的优势和适用场景

    重要的是,在解决问题的同时,我们也要加强密码管理和安全意识,避免类似情况的再次发生

    希望本文能帮助您顺利解决虚拟机密码遗忘的问题,并为您的IT生活带来便利